明岩古寺 (Mingyan Ancient Temple) is a huge complex of Buddhist temples which was built into a secluded valley. The narrow gorge has numerous spacious shelters, which are almost caves, but are mostly lit by daylight. Over the centuries the temple was built not only in the valley but also into the adjacent caves.
These are tectonic caves created by movements of the rocks as a result of erosion, which cause a steep gradient. The blocks moved apart or simply collapsed, enclosing some space. The results are huge chambers with almost plain walls and no speleothems. The rocks are sandstones and conglomerates.
